Aldridge Scores 21, Bison Beat Hawks

BeachwoodBison.org recaps Tuesday's girls basketball win

Editor's Note: This post was submitted to Beachwood Patch by BeachwoodBison.org. Visit their website for more on the Bison. After cruising to its first two victories, Beachwood’s girls’ basketball team was pushed until the final whistle in a 44-40 victory over Hawken on Tuesday. The Bison (3-0, 2-0 in the Chagrin Valley Conference) played without their only senior, Terrina Robinson, who sat out with an illness, and junior standout Mikah Aldridge found herself in early foul trouble. That forced head coach Mike Coreno to alter his starting lineup and rotation. “The younger kids stepped up,” Coreno said. “Little by little they seem to be getting more comfortable in the rotations.” Beachwood led 22-19 at the half and 27-26 after three quarters…
